Abstract
Spray oil compositions for controlling post-emergence weeds comprising a non-phytotoxic paraffinic oil and an herbicide selected from the group consisting of cyclohexyl-3-trimethylene-5,6-uracil; 1-n-butyl-3(3,4-dichlorophenyl)-1-methyl urea; 5-amino-4-chloro-2-phenyl pyridazine-3-one; and 3-methoxycarbonyl amino phenyl-n-(3-methyl phenyl)-carbamate.
